Zombies as fiction have roots in mythology and fact; their allure persists through various media.
02:10
Zombies originated from Haiti as a symbol of subjugation following the country's slave uprising, now widely represented in media globally.
04:32
The origin of zombies lies with Haitian voodoo practices where traditional African religious concepts merged with Christianity under French colonial rule, symbolizing the struggle for identity amid oppression.
06:38
Zombies, as understood within Haitian voodoo culture, symbolize the fear of eternal servitude for suicides and represent spiritual entities bound in limbo.
08:51
Zombies entered Western pop culture through sensationalized accounts of Haitian voodoo, evolving in the horror genre from mindless slaves into flesh-eating beings driven by instinct and disease.
